Operating model design

We design your business operations to execute your strategy and successfully deliver the service proposition

The key to competitive advantage is an operating model that turns your strategy into reality

Your operating model provides your business operations with an architecture aligned to your business strategy:

Laying the foundations for successful delivery

Increasing competitive advantage

Creating business agility

The right operating model ensures that key elements of a business operation are aligned, making it possible to deliver both the business strategy and service proposition.

Symptoms that indicate that you should consider redesigning your operating model:

Digital deficiency
You are being left behind in a market shifting to digital services or interfacing with customer through digital channels

Partial restructuring
An operating model element has been changed in isolation (e.g. organisation, offshoring etc)

Customer dissatisfaction
Persistent failure to meet your customer’s expectations for service experience, quality, cost or timely delivery

Performance challenge
You need a significant step change in performance to meet strategic or budget targets

Strategic misalignment
Your business strategy, customer segment, regulation or service proposition has changed

Merger or acquisition
You need to create alignment and synergy between two or more distinct and different operating models

Restoring confidence to credit management

The credit operations function of a high street bank was under the spotlight from the FCA over concerns about treating customers fairly. There were a number of structural issues that needed addressing, including end to end accountability for customers, risk controls and performance. Following a rapid diagnostic, a collaborative operating model design project was initiated, working closely with the whole leadership team through interactive workshops.

  • A business strategy for Credit Operations was agreed and developed into an operations strategy. This led to the creation of design requirements for the operating model.
  • Central shared services were created for admin, risk and strategy, with separate functions for each core product area. The site footprint was also consolidated.
  • Clarity of accountability and a well defined risk and controls function substantially increased confidence in complying with bank policy and minimising risk.
